> During bringing up Xen on Renesas Lager board we faced with problem.
> A lot of Xen sources relies on statement, that IRQ number is less then
> 256 and variables, parameters, fields etc. are of type uint8_t. But we
> can have IRQs, that are greater then 255, for example on RCar H2 SoC.
> Also, as I saw from one of your latest commits, GICv supports 1020
> physical interrupts. As a result, overflow can occur. So it seems
> logical to increase all irq staff to uint16_t or uint32_t. We have
> local patches for increasing some structures, functions etc.
> But before pushing these patches I want to know your opinion, what do
> you think about this problem? What type should we use uint16_t or
> uint32_t? How to find all places where uint8_t type is used for IRQ?

I'm a bit surprised. I looked through the hypervisor and libxl and I was 
able to found only one place (DOMCTL_irq_permission which is not really 
supported on ARM). We are usually using uint32_t/int for IRQ.

Can you give an example of files/structures using uint8_t for IRQ?

Ideally the IRQ should use uint32_t. This is allow us to support LPIs 
(IRQ number start a 8192 up to a very high number).
